Will Halo Multiplayer Be Free?

In the gaming world, one of the most frequently asked questions surrounding the upcoming Halo title is whether its multiplayer component will be free-to-play. With the anticipation building for the latest installment in the iconic Halo series, fans and critics alike are eager to know if they will have to pay for access to the game’s online features. This article delves into the potential implications of a free multiplayer experience for Halo and its players.

The debate over whether Halo multiplayer will be free is not without reason. Microsoft has historically charged for multiplayer access in its Xbox titles, including previous iterations of Halo. However, the gaming industry has seen a shift towards free-to-play models in recent years, with many developers and publishers opting for this approach to attract a broader audience.

A free multiplayer Halo could significantly boost the game’s player base, as it would remove the initial barrier of entry for new players. This would likely lead to a more vibrant and diverse community, as more players from different backgrounds and skill levels would have the opportunity to join in on the action. Additionally, a free-to-play model could encourage more developers to create content and mods for the game, further enhancing the overall experience.

On the other hand, a free multiplayer Halo could also have some drawbacks. With more players comes increased competition, which might lead to a more toxic and frustrating experience for some. Moreover, developers might rely on microtransactions to generate revenue, potentially leading to a pay-to-win environment where players with deeper pockets have an unfair advantage.

As of now, there is no official word from Microsoft regarding the multiplayer model for the upcoming Halo title. However, industry analysts and rumors suggest that the company is considering a free-to-play model to keep up with the changing trends in the gaming industry. If this is indeed the case, it could mark a significant shift for the Halo series and potentially redefine the multiplayer landscape for the better.

In conclusion, while it remains uncertain whether Halo multiplayer will be free, the possibility of such a move has sparked a lively discussion among fans and industry experts. A free multiplayer Halo could open the game up to a wider audience and foster a more vibrant community, but it also raises concerns about the potential impact on gameplay and revenue. Only time will tell if Microsoft will take the leap and embrace the free-to-play model for the iconic Halo series.
